Corruption Perception Index: Can Malaysia Improve Its Ranking?

Dr Muhammad Mohan, President, Transparency International Malaysia

08-Jan-25 08:45

Corruption Perception Index: Can Malaysia Improve Its Ranking?

We speak to Dr Muhammad Mohan, President of Transparency International Malaysia about when the 2024 edition of the Corruption Perception Index might be released and how prolific graft cases from last year might affect our rankings in the index.
